How to read this: the line is the closing price over time. The two dashed lines are moving averages — the average price over the last 50 and 200 trading days — which smooth out daily noise to show the broader trend. Price above its moving averages reflects recent strength; below reflects recent weakness. Use the buttons to change the time range. Prices are end-of-day, not live.

The F-Score adds one point for each of several year-on-year signs of improving profitability, lower leverage and better efficiency. Higher is generally stronger.

Based on 6 of the 9 signals — the rest need data not available for this stock.
